Index.php и белая страница

И всё прочее, что касается HTML
Правила форума
Убедительная просьба юзать теги [code] при оформлении листингов.
Сообщения не оформленные должным образом имеют все шансы быть незамеченными.
Аватара пользователя
mr. brightside
сержант
Сообщения: 260
Зарегистрирован: 2010-04-17 17:32:39
Откуда: Saint-Petersburg

Index.php и белая страница

Непрочитанное сообщение mr. brightside » 2011-05-12 16:39:12

Добрый день, уважаемые!

Хапнул тут нежданчика на тему белой страницы вместо страницы с контентом.

Сейчас в директории с сайтом дежит сразу две версии оного - старый и новый. Новый открывается по страницам indexn.php, а старый, традиционно - index.php. С новыми индексами все супер, сайт работает на ура. Но, админка открывается через старый index.php. Проблема в том, что при заходе на index.php я получаю белый экран :unknown:

Что предшествовало:

Было все замечательно. Вчера админка работала, старые страницы index.php тоже. Программист копался в исходниках битрикса в папке:

Код: Выделить всё

/usr/local/www/site/htdocs/bitrix/php_interface/ru
Сегодня с утра index.php открываться перестали. Вернее - белая страничка.

Не долго думаю я повключал дебаги php, битрикса и стал читать логи апача с пхп:

Код: Выделить всё

php.ini:
--------------------
error_reporting = E_ALL
display_errors = On
display_startup_errors = On
log_errors = On
log_errors_max_len = 1024
error_log = /var/log/php-error.log

.htaccess в папке с index.php
--------------------
php_value display_errors 1
php_value display_startup_errors 1

dbconn.php
--------------------
        $DBDebug = true;
И это не помогло. Ошибки не выводятся, логи найчистейшие.

Начал смотреть содержимое index.php - там есть ссылки на разные файлы в каталоге сайта, но в папку, в которой копался программист нету ни одной ссылки :unknown:

Решил переименовать index.php в test.php - потом полез в браузер и попытался открыть test.php. Получил белый экран - значит, косяк точно в index.php.

И бэкапа выдернул копию - белый экран.

У кого есть идеи? =))

Ингридиенты - FreeBSD 7.3, apache 1.3.41. php 5.2.17, mysql 4.1.25, bitrix 3.3.5.
Только FreeBSD, только хардкор

Хостинговая компания Host-Food.ru
Хостинг HostFood.ru
 

Услуги хостинговой компании Host-Food.ru

Хостинг HostFood.ru

Тарифы на хостинг в России, от 12 рублей: https://www.host-food.ru/tariffs/hosting/
Тарифы на виртуальные сервера (VPS/VDS/KVM) в РФ, от 189 руб.: https://www.host-food.ru/tariffs/virtualny-server-vps/
Выделенные сервера, Россия, Москва, от 2000 рублей (HP Proliant G5, Intel Xeon E5430 (2.66GHz, Quad-Core, 12Mb), 8Gb RAM, 2x300Gb SAS HDD, P400i, 512Mb, BBU):
https://www.host-food.ru/tariffs/vydelennyi-server-ds/
Недорогие домены в популярных зонах: https://www.host-food.ru/domains/

Аватара пользователя
mr. brightside
сержант
Сообщения: 260
Зарегистрирован: 2010-04-17 17:32:39
Откуда: Saint-Petersburg

Re: Index.php и белая страница

Непрочитанное сообщение mr. brightside » 2011-05-12 17:06:12

Дополню:

в админку же можно попасть и напрямую - это было бы даже лучше, да только там нет полей для авторизации.

Поясню.

Набиваю в адресной строке ссылку http://my.site.ru/bitrix/index.php. Получаю страничку, где есть надпись "авторизация" и под ней нету никаких полей для ввода логина/пароля. Нажатие на кнопку "административный раздел" не приводит к появлению таких полей, поэтому я :unknown:

Есть повелители битрикса? может где-нибудь что-нибудь надо раскомментировать?
Только FreeBSD, только хардкор